Beyond the Basic Black Suit

Let's be real, a black suit is always a safe bet. But a Quinceañera is a celebration! Think about injecting some personality. Instead of plain black, consider charcoal grey, a sophisticated navy blue, or even a dark burgundy. These colors offer a more modern and celebratory feel, while still maintaining a respectful formality.

Tip #1: Consider the Color Scheme. Often, the Quinceañera has chosen a specific color palette for the event. Chat with her family (or sneak a peek at the invitation!) to see if you can subtly incorporate a matching hue into your tie, pocket square, or even your socks. It's a thoughtful touch that shows you're paying attention.

The Blazer: A Versatile Player

A blazer can be your secret weapon. Pair it with dress pants for a more formal look, or dress it down slightly with chinos. A well-tailored blazer instantly elevates your outfit, making you look sharp and put-together.

Think about the fabric: Linen is great for warmer weather Quinceañeras, while tweed or a heavier wool blend works well for cooler climates. Velvet blazers? Absolutely! Especially for an evening celebration.

Shirts: More Than Just White

While a crisp white dress shirt is a classic, don't be afraid to experiment. Light blue, subtle patterns, or even a muted pastel can add a touch of flair. Just make sure the shirt is well-fitted and wrinkle-free. Nobody wants to see a sloppy shirt.

Pro Tip: Invest in a good quality undershirt. It will keep you cool and comfortable, and prevent sweat stains from ruining your look. Trust us, you'll thank us later, especially if you end up on the dance floor.

Accessorize with Confidence

Accessories are where you can really showcase your personal style. A stylish tie, a sophisticated watch, a cool belt – these details can make all the difference.

Pocket Square Power: A pocket square is a small but mighty accessory. Experiment with different folds and patterns to add a pop of color and personality to your outfit.

Shoes Matter: Your shoes should be clean, polished, and appropriate for the occasion. Dress shoes are a must. Think oxfords, loafers, or even dress boots. Avoid sneakers or sandals unless explicitly stated otherwise (highly unlikely!).

Comfort is Key

No matter what you choose to wear, make sure you're comfortable. A Quinceañera is a long event, often lasting several hours. You'll be dancing, eating, and socializing, so you want to be able to move freely and feel confident.

Fit is Everything: Avoid clothes that are too tight or too loose. A well-fitted outfit will always look better than something that doesn't fit properly.

Remember the reason: While looking good is important, remember that the Quinceañera is about celebrating the young woman of the hour. Your outfit should complement the occasion, not overshadow it. Be respectful, be supportive, and be ready to celebrate!
